The Legacies of Caribbean Radical Politics
This book is a pan-Caribbean and multidisciplinary study of the successes, failures, lessons, ongoing efforts, and prospects of Left politics from across the Caribbean in the twentieth and twenty-first centuries. This book was published as a special issue of Interventions: International Journal of Postcolonial Studies.
